#map {
	list-style: none;
	padding: 0; margin: 0;
}

#map li {
	margin: 1.2em 0;
}

#map a {
	color: #000; background: url(icon_folder.gif) left 3px no-repeat;
	text-decoration: none;
	padding-left: 15px;
}

#map a:active, #map a:hover {
	text-decoration: underline;
}

#map ul {
	list-style: none;
	padding: 0; margin: 5px 15px;
}

#map ul li {
	margin: 0;
}

#map ul a {
	color: #666; background: url(icon_page.gif) left 2px no-repeat;
	padding-left: 12px;
}

#map ul a:active, #map ul a:hover {
	color: #ff0000; background: url(icon_active_page.gif) left 2px no-repeat;
	text-decoration: none;
}
